Introduction. Wide band beams are very commonly used as a structural floor system in Australia. This system consists of concrete slabs spanning between wide, shallow beams and is popular due to its ease of construction and shallow overall floor depth (allowing for reduced floor-to-floor heights).

WebNov 18, 2024 · Bond beams are a horizontal feature embedded in a wall to add support to the structure. The bond beam is made up of specialized blocks that are filled with grout to hold a sturdy steel bar in place. They add steel reinforcement to structures that might need more than just traditional CMUs to hold it up sufficiently.
